IO模塊通訊故障
IO模塊通訊故障
在現代工業自動化系統中,IO模塊作為核心組件,負責設備與控制系統之間的數據交換。通訊故障是影響系統穩定性與可靠性的常見問題,尤其是當數據傳輸中斷時,可能導致生產線停滯、設備故障等***系列連鎖反應。本文將深入探討IO模塊通訊故障的常見原因、檢測方法以及解決方案,幫助工程師識別潛在問題,及時恢復系統的正常運行,確保生產過程的高效與穩定。
IO模塊通訊故障的常見原因
硬件故障:IO模塊的硬件故障是通訊故障中為直接的原因之***。硬件故障包括電路板損壞、連接端口松動或故障、接線問題等。這些問題可能導致信號無法正常傳輸,從而影響系統的正常通訊。
信號干擾:在工業環境中,外界電磁干擾(EMI)是導致通訊中斷的常見原因。高頻電流、電機運行產生的電磁波等,都可能對通訊信號造成干擾,導致數據傳輸錯誤或丟失。
軟件問題:除了硬件問題,軟件的配置或編程錯誤也可能導致通訊故障。例如,通訊協議配置不當、程序邏輯錯誤或控制系統與IO模塊的通信參數不***致等,都可能引發通訊問題。
網絡故障:如果IO模塊通過網絡與上***控制系統進行數據交換,那么網絡的故障或延遲也可能導致通訊中斷。網絡帶寬不足、網絡設備故障或網絡拓撲結構問題等,都會影響通訊質量。
電源問題:IO模塊需要穩定的電源供應。如果電壓不穩或電源中斷,將導致模塊無法正常工作,進而引發通訊故障。
IO模塊通訊故障的檢測方法
硬件自檢:通過定期的硬件檢測,檢查IO模塊及其接口是否正常工作。可以使用萬用表、示波器等工具檢查電路板的電壓和信號波形,確保硬件設備沒有出現問題。
診斷工具:許多IO模塊都配備了內置的診斷功能。通過控制系統的診斷軟件,可以實時監控通訊狀態,檢查是否存在錯誤碼或通訊中斷的警告。
信號檢測:通過使用信號分析儀等專業工具,檢測通訊信號的質量。對于工業總線(如Modbus、Profibus等),可以分析信號的強度、波形和延遲情況,以便發現可能的通訊問題。
軟件調試:通過調試軟件來檢查通訊協議是否正確配置,確認系統之間的通信參數是否***致,確保沒有程序邏輯錯誤。
解決IO模塊通訊故障的方案
檢查硬件連接:確認IO模塊的連接是否穩固。重新插拔電纜,檢查電纜的狀態和接頭是否有腐蝕或損壞。如果發現硬件問題,及時更換損壞的部件。
優化電磁環境:為了減少外部干擾,可以通過增加電磁屏蔽、使用抗干擾的電纜或改進設備布置來降低電磁干擾對通訊的影響。
調整通訊參數:檢查通訊協議和網絡配置,確保所有設備的設置***致。調整波特率、校驗位等參數,以達到佳的通訊性能。
網絡優化:若通訊故障與網絡質量有關,可以嘗試更換或優化網絡設備,增加帶寬,優化網絡拓撲結構。確保網絡連接穩定,減少延遲和數據丟包。
定期維護與更新:定期進行系統檢查和設備維護,及時更新軟件和固件,以確保系統與IO模塊的兼容性和通訊穩定性。
結語
IO模塊通訊故障的排查與解決,涉及硬件、軟件、網絡等多個方面。通過合理的檢測與排查方法,及時發現并解決問題,可以有效提升系統的穩定性和可靠性。對于自動化系統的工程師來說,掌握故障分析和處理技巧,能夠確保生產線在高效、安全的環境中穩定運行。
注:文章來源于網絡,如有侵權,請聯系刪除